Seared Salmon with Asparagus and Cauliflower Mash
Enjoy a beautifully balanced dinner featuring a tender, wild salmon fillet seared to perfection, paired with vibrant, lightly roasted asparagus and a creamy cauliflower mash. This dish is designed to satisfy your tastebuds while aligning with your specific macro and calorie goals.
INGREDIENTS
200 grams Wild Salmon Fillet
100 grams Asparagus
150 grams Cauliflower
Olive Oil Cooking Spray
Salt, Pepper, Garlic Powder
PREPARATION
Pat the salmon dry with a paper towel and season both sides with salt, pepper, and a light dusting of garlic powder.
Preheat a nonstick skillet over medium-high heat and lightly coat with olive oil cooking spray.
Place the salmon skin-side down (if applicable) and sear for 3-4 minutes, then carefully flip and cook for an additional 3-4 minutes until the salmon is just cooked through.
Meanwhile, steam the asparagus and cauliflower florets until tender. This usually takes about 5-7 minutes.
For the cauliflower mash, transfer the steamed cauliflower to a blender or food processor. Blend until smooth, adding a pinch of salt and pepper to taste. If desired, you can add a small splash of water to achieve a creamier consistency.
Plate a serving of the cauliflower mash, top with the seared salmon, and arrange the steamed asparagus on the side.
